Top 8 Hostels in Dubrovnik

If you are backpacking or just love the social scene of hostels, here are 8 of the best hostels in Dubrovnik. They provide great facilities, excellent locations, and a warm, welcoming atmosphere.

City Walls Hostel

Located in Dubrovnik's historic Old Town, City Walls Hostel provides a charming, authentic experience. The hostel is situated in a building with old stone walls, offering clean, cozy dorms and a friendly staff that ensures that the place is warm. It's an excellent location, meaning that you will be minutes from the main attractions like Rector's Palace and Stradun. City Walls Hostel is ideal for people who are interested in history, providing a perfect mix of comfort and convenience in order to fully absorb the city's vibrant culture and stunning surroundings.

Hostel Angelina Old Town

Hostel Angelina Old Town remains one of the most wanted hostels for travelers requiring affordable yet well-located accommodation within Dubrovnik. Based in the heart of the Old Town, with clean dorms, rooms, and a spacious room for sharing with fellow visitors, the staff are warm-hearted and extremely helpful, showing valuable tips and recommendations concerning the surroundings. With its central location, it is only a short walk to famous monuments such as the City Walls and Stradun. If you want to have the taste of Dubrovnik but also save money on your expenses, Hostel Angelina will be one of the great choices.

My Way Hostel Dubrovnik

For a quieter, more relaxed stay, My Way Hostel Dubrovnik is a great option. Just a short bus ride from Dubrovniks Old Town, this hostel offers larger dorms, free Wi-Fi, and a cozy atmosphere. While slightly removed from the tourist crowds, its still close enough for easy access to major attractions. The hostel provides a peaceful retreat after a day of sightseeing, with its friendly staff and communal spaces designed for socializing. Whether youre traveling solo or in a group, My Way Hostel offers a calm haven with great value for money.

Hostel Sol

Hostel Sol is ideally situated near Dubrovniks main bus station and ferry terminal, making it a perfect base for travelers heading to nearby islands. This modern, sleek hostel offers spacious dorms and private rooms, with excellent amenities and a welcoming atmosphere. Its proximity to transportation hubs makes it an ideal choice for those planning day trips to destinations like Lokrum or Mljet. Guests appreciate the hostels cleanliness, the well-designed spaces, and the relaxed vibe. If youre looking for comfort and convenience at an affordable price, Hostel Sol is one of the best budget options in Dubrovnik.

Hostel Free Bird

Hostel Free Bird offers a modern and laid-back vibe, making it a great choice for travelers who appreciate a calm environment. Located just outside the Old Town, it offers a quieter stay while still being close to local shops, restaurants, and bus routes. The hostel features well-maintained dorms and private rooms, with a communal area perfect for socializing with fellow guests. Cleanliness is a top priority here, and the friendly staff adds to the welcoming atmosphere.

Hostel 365 for U

With its contemporary design and fantastic amenities, Hostel 365 for U caters to travelers who enjoy a polished hostel experience. Each dorm bed comes with its light, power outlet, and privacy curtain, providing added comfort and privacy. Located within walking distance of Gru harbor, the hostel is well-placed for exploring the quieter side of Dubrovnik, with easy access to local shops and attractions. The friendly staff and modern facilities make this a popular choice for both solo travelers and small groups seeking a comfortable, well-located budget accommodation option.

Dubrovnik Backpackers Club

Dubrovnik Backpackers Club offers more than just a place to sleepits a true community experience. This family-run hostel is known for its homey atmosphere, with guests enjoying home-cooked meals and organized tours. Located in Lapad, a quieter part of the city, it provides a relaxed retreat away from the tourist crowds. The hostels welcoming staff and comfortable accommodations make it a favorite among those who prefer a slower pace. Whether youre seeking relaxation or adventure, Dubrovnik Backpackers Club offers a warm, social environment that makes you feel at home.

Old Town Hostel Dubrovnik

Housed in a 400-year-old building, Old Town Hostel Dubrovnik offers a unique blend of historic charm and modern convenience. Situated in the heart of Dubrovniks medieval center, the hostel puts you steps away from top attractions like the City Walls and the Stradun. The friendly staff are always ready to offer insider tips and help you navigate the city. Guests appreciate the hostels clean, comfortable dorms and private rooms, along with the cozy communal areas that encourage interaction with fellow travelers.
